TDS Law hosts ‘Working with MTI’ seminar

Lawyers Meghan Ross and Maggie Spezzano from TDS Law hosted an in-person seminar called ‘Working with MTI.’ This session helped attendees understand, navigate and apply the Province of Manitoba’s general conditions.

The presentation focused on three areas when working with MTI: early considerations, general conditions and liens. Ross and Spezzano covered the key features of these general conditions and discussed best practices to consider for any projects. 

Key takeaways from the presentation include ensuring you have proper documentation and a good paper trail, understanding if something is considered extra work and ensuring proper review of defined terms. Attendees received the slide presentation, post-seminar, for their records and review.
